Connect the audio cables between the AUDIO OUT (L/R) jacks on the back of your DVD player and the corresponding Audio Input jacks on your TV/Monitor. Connect the video cable between the VIDEO OUT jack on the back of your DVD player and the corresponding Video Input jack on your TV/Monitor. (If you have S-video jack on you TV/Monitor, connect this jack. ) Caution When you connect the DVD player to your TV/Monitor, be sure to turn off the power and unplug both units before making any connection. If you connect the DVD player to a VCR, the playback picture will be distorted because DVD video discs are copy protected. Do not set the Digital Audio Output of this DVD player to "PCM" unless you are connecting the Digital Audio jack of this DVD player to an AV decoder that has Dolby Digital decoding function. When you press the SLOW button Play speed changes in the sequence of 1/2X, 1/4X, 1/6X, 1/7X each time pressing the SLOW button. When you press the SLOW button Reverse Play speed changes in the sequence of 1/2X, 1/4X, 1/6X, 1/7X each time pressing the SLOW button. When you press the NEXT button Moves to the next chapter/track. Press the PLAY button to play at normal speed. Slow Playback does not operate while playing CD/MP3. To Scan video or CD tracks (DVD/CD) To Scan Each scene. 1 Press the button (FR/FF). Play speed changes in the sequence of 2X, 4X, 8X, 20X. Press the PLAY button to play at normal speed. Fast playback does not operate with MP3's. 1 Press the PAUSE button with the unit in the Pause mode. You can step frame by frame each time the PAUSE button is pressed. [. . . ]
